You can't compare Kadabra to Musharna. Kadabra can't take a hit to save its life even with Eviolite, while Musharna does exactly the opposite. Musharna can actually use the Sp. Def boosts from Calm Mind while Kadabra still falls to a soft breeze.

You don't play them the same way either. You set up maybe one CM or a Sub on a forced switch, then start attacking, while Musharna accumulates a few CM boosts then goes on the offensive, and can stop to regain health while Kadabra has to lose coverage to run Recover (which hasn't been very good on t since RBY).
 
I know they aren't really comparable, I'd just rather use Kadabra if I'm going for a Psychic type on my team. Besides, Kadabra makes up for its terrible defenses with immunities to weather, hazards, and any other damage that isn't a direct attack. The differences between the two are bulk, attack method, and how they deal with status. I prefer Kadabra simply because it's powerful without setting up.
Really it just comes down to what people need. If you need a bulky set-up sweeper, Musharna is pretty good, although can be walled by Dark types. If you'd rather have something that can hit hard right out of the gate, Kadabra is fast and pretty strong, it's just not going to take a neutral hit unless it's behind a sub.
